How to Choose an Asbestos Attorney for Your Mesothelioma Case

Mesothelioma is a dreadful illness caused by asbestos exposure. It was a widely used building material until companies started hiding the risks.

A skilled mesothelioma lawyer can help patients and their families receive compensation from asbestos trust funds. When selecting an attorney victims should consider the following factors:

Find a company that has a practice nationwide

When deciding on an asbestos lawyer to represent you, it is recommended to choose a lawyer who is specialized in mesothelioma and has experience with national cases. Mesothelioma lawyers from national firms have a national network of lawyers and can find out more quickly the time, place and manner in which asbestos was exposed. They have access to specialized tools such as asbestos product databases and historical case records. Additionally, companies with an international presence have worked with many local courts. This allows them to develop large lawsuits and move quickly through the legal system.

A mesothelioma lawyer firm should be licensed to practice in your state and be well-aware of state laws. Mesothelioma lawsuits are often filed in more than one state, and each state's laws vary. A nationwide firm can offer the benefit of knowing all the laws and regulations of every state, including the complicated statutes.

It is also crucial to find an attorney who has experience handling cases for victims with different backgrounds. Mesothelioma victims are from a variety of industries, and each has their own histories of exposure to asbestos. A mesothelioma lawyer ought to be able to assist victims find the right legal strategy to ensure they receive the compensation they deserve.

It is crucial to find an asbestos lawyer who is aware of the mesothelioma effects on patients and their families. Attorneys must be compassionate and understanding towards their clients and listen to their concerns or queries. They should also be able to explain complicated legal concepts in easy-to-understand terms.

The best mesothelioma lawyers will have a long history of fighting for asbestos victims and families. They'll be able identify potential parties of liability (such as asbestos producers or insurers) and negotiate a settlement to get you the money you require. In addition, they should have a solid understanding of the way mesothelioma affects patients and their families, and are prepared to fight for the compensation they are entitled to.

Look for Experience

If you are looking for a mesothelioma lawyer make sure you find one with plenty of experience and an impressive track record. Visit their website to find out how long they've been in business and what kinds of cases they've handled. You can request references from former clients and community groups.

Mesothelioma can be a nebulous disease that requires a lot of knowledge of asbestos litigation. Expert lawyers can 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ve. They will know how they can calculate the value of your claim. They will ensure that you receive a payment that covers both your previous and future damages.

An experienced attorney can assist you in identifying possible sources of exposure. This is important because it can be difficult to pinpoint the source and time you were exposed. They will look into your past work experience and look for connections to other asbestos-related victims. They will have the funds to hire experts, like industrial hygienists or medical professionals.

A mesothelioma attorney with experience can also make a claim in your name before deadlines set by the law. They will also know which states' laws will give you the best chances of receiving compensation. They will also be able to apply for VA benefits or trust fund claims in the event of need.

Many asbestos-related companies that are responsible for exposure are insolvent. Companies that dealt with asbestos often filed for bankruptcy to avoid being sued by mesothelioma patients. Many victims did not receive compensation as a result of this.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ims to receive compensation from trust funds that were set by these corporations.

Veterans who were exposed asbestos while serving in the military may be qualified to receive comp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ims to file VA lawsuits and mesothelioma claims against their former employers. They can help veterans receive VA pensions and health care benefits that they did not receive. This helps ensure that veterans and their families are properly cared for following their asbestos-related illnesses.

Find a firm that Works on a Contingency Basis

In addition to finding the best lawyer for your situation You should also find a lawyer that is on a contingency basis. This guarantees that your attorney is attentive to your needs and will do everything in his power to secure the amount you deserve. Furthermore should your lawyer not succeed in winning your case, they will not receive any fees. This setup puts your interests first and can assist you in getting the mesothelioma compensation that you are entitled to and require.

Mesothelioma lawyers have access to resources many other lawyers do not have access to, including asbestos databases and experts. They are also aware of how to effectively examine a mesothelioma claim by examining the victim's past work history and relating it to possible exposure incidents that could be decades old.

Additionally, a seasoned mesothelioma lawyer will be able to determine the best kind of legal action for their client. Personal injury lawsuits can be filed by mesothelioma sufferers or their relatives in order to secure an amount of money from companies that are responsible for their exposure to asbestos. Wrongful death lawsuits are filed by relatives of victims who have died as a result of asbestos exposure. These claims are pursued on behalf of the estate of the deceased.

Asbestos trust fund funds are set up by dissolved or bankrupt asbestos companies to pay out claims for asbestos-related diseases. Settlements or jury awards are generally used to resolve these claims. Veterans who have been diagnosed as having an asbestos law-related disease, such as mesothelioma, are eligible to receive VA benefits.

It is important to hire a mesothelioma lawyer as soon as you can in the event that you have been exposed to asbestos. Asbestos attorneys have the connections and experience to employ mesothelioma experts like industrial hygienists and medical experts. They will also be able to submit your lawsuit to the appropriate court jurisdiction. They will also be able to identify any procedural errors which could undermine your claim and stop you from receiving the money you deserve.
